Output 97bb6d994129462379602de03f7494b3289bb345fc076fd756ce3dcb1f8f21dd:3

value
43151079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d12cf397c68d7ba43bcfea86c4345d6c85fa840 OP_EQUAL
address
MU466jGqPidAPMtMZdesKLpwkNB1y4TT95
transaction
97bb6d994129462379602de03f7494b3289bb345fc076fd756ce3dcb1f8f21dd
spent
true